The injections wells in our county, and other Ohio River border counties, are all the rage. WV has intentionally made it incredibly difficult to inject, and you can't inject in NY or PA, so Ohio has become a destination for brine and other produced fluids from the Utica and Marcellus basins. The vast majority of what goes downhole via the multiple wells in this county, originates from WV, PA, and NY. The ODNR has all but rolled out the red carpet in the past thanks to uber-friendly regulations and now some of the wells that were drilled to ODNR spec, are failing.
